Producer

Meerlust

Meerlust wines embody a harmonious blend of tradition and innovation, showcasing the elegance of varietals like Cabernet Sauvignon, Merlot, and Chardonnay. These wines are renowned for their depth, complexity, and vibrant flavors, often featuring dark fruit notes, subtle oak, and a touch of spice. The estate’s storied history, steeped in over two centuries of winemaking, reflects a commitment to quality that resonates in each bottle, transporting the palate on a remarkable journey.

Grape

Carménère

In the sun-drenched valleys of Chile, where the Andes cradle vineyards in their verdant embrace, the Carménère grape ripens, cloaked in deep purple. Its wine spills forth with aromas of blackberry and a hint of green bell pepper, evoking the crispness of summer mornings. Rich and velvety on the palate, it unfurls layers of dark fruit mingled with a whisper of baking spice. Can a single sip truly encapsulate centuries of resilience and rediscovery?
